Understanding the Metro Housing Bond Quarterly Form
The Metro Housing Bond Quarterly Form serves as a critical tool for tracking financial information related to housing bonds in the Oregon metro area, particularly in regions like North Portland. These bonds aim to address the housing affordability crisis faced by many communities by funding the construction and maintenance of affordable homes. The importance of this form lies in its role in ensuring transparency and accountability in how funds are utilized, thus directly impacting the progress of housing initiatives.
